Comments (9)Hello Tara. This is fantastic space for an entrance hall and you have already made a good start with the panelling and colour scheme. The area in-front of the fireplace would make a lovely reading space. As you already have 2 other separate living areas then I do not feel it is necessary to have such a big sofa in here. I would consider putting in 2 armchairs with a coffee table opposite the fireplace and by doing so it will still zone off this area from the hallway. I would then look at putting in a round table in the hallway area (the space can certainly take it) to really give you a 'wow' when you walk in and it will really help the space to flow as it looks like you can either walk in and straight up to the stairs, through to the rooms at the back or in to the reading area.
